The IPO comprises a fresh issue of 1.03 crore equity shares aggregating to ₹499.10 crores and an offer for sale (OFS) of 6.83 crore equity shares worth ₹3,311.21 crores. The price band for the issue is fixed at ₹461 to ₹485 per share.

About Company

Incorporated in 1996, Indo-MIM is a global leader in manufacturing precision engineering components using metal injection molding (MIM) technology. The company offers end-to-end solutions including mold design, tooling, finishing, and assembly.
